PeptideMapper does not report peptide hits, but protein hits #69

given:

a peptide.csv as

DKEKEK
EKEKEK

and a protein.fasta (expected hit in second line) as

>sp|Q95283|COX41_PIG Cytochrome c oxidase subunit 4 isoform 1, mitochondrial (Fragment) OS=Sus scrofa OX=9823 GN=COX4I1 PE=2 SV=1
MLATRVFNLIGRRAISTSVCVRAHGSXVKSEDYALPVYVDRRDYPLPDVAHVKNLSASQKA
XKEKEK
ASWSSLSMDEKVELYRLKFNESFAEMNRST

the result of PeptideMapper is:

XKEKEK,Q95283,62

The position is correct, but PeptideMapper does not tell how many peptides were matched to this position (here it's 2).
To perform this mapping, one needs external tools, which is a bit inconvenient.

I would hope to see a result like:

EKEKEK,Q95283,62
DKEKEK,Q95283,62

which would tell me the actual peptide sequence(s) matched
